2007 PRECISION CYCLE WORKS (PCW) "PRODUCTION" BUILT CUSTOM CHOPPER



THIS FACTORY/CUSTOM BUILT SOFT TAIL IS A CLASSIC PIECE OF CLASSIC DETROIT WITH THE OLD ENGLISH "D" ON THE RIGHT SIDE COVER IS ITS SIGNATURE
It's tough looking with a Rock Star flare!
Base price on this factory built head turner model form PRECISION CYCLE WORKS (PCW) starts at $23,000.
The bike finished was over $32,000...
With enclosed chrome primary and belt drive secondary.
Over sized custom painted fuel tank and matching fenders
Large 250/40 R18 rear tire has custom chrome wheels and custom matching rotors

Last year, the “American Chopper” TV franchise was reinvigorated by a special live show that brought in nearly 5 million total viewers and was the most-watched show among men of the entire TV schedule’s night. Called “American Chopper Live – The Build-Off,” the show pitted the Orange County Chopper crew against Paul Jr. Designs and the irascible malcontent Jesse James.
